Output 38ecb16221e39ff61c93b6031e2cd368c24ccd73d7acb75a080eb65cb8def6ff:1

value
24960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6252d8b62f683a238d08f8dc059d207a2e270cda OP_EQUAL
address
A1QA8U32E4VRjUAhHqxn2zeLn4fo9XgKFi
transaction
38ecb16221e39ff61c93b6031e2cd368c24ccd73d7acb75a080eb65cb8def6ff